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Long-tailed dunnart | Mixe Treefrog |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Amphibia (Amphibians) |
| Order | Dasyuromorphia (Dasyuromorphia) | Anura (Frogs & Toads) |
| Family | Dasyuridae | Hylidae |
| Genus | Sminthopsis | Megastomatohyla |
| Species | Sminthopsis longicaudata | Megastomatohyla mixe |
